Deciphering RTP and Its Industry Significance
RTP essentially measures the proportion of wagered money that a slot machine is designed to return to players over an extended period. For example, an RTP of 96% suggests that, on average, players can expect to recover £96 for every £100 wagered, though this is distantly theoretical rather than a guarantee for individual sessions. High RTP slots are often preferred by seasoned players seeking better odds and more consistent returns, outperforming lower RTP counterparts in terms of player trust and satisfaction.
While the RTP percentage is pivotal, it interacts with other game elements such as volatility, paylines, and bonus features, creating a complex landscape where strategic choices influence outcomes. Consequently, understanding these dynamics enables operators and players to make informed decisions.

Industry Data Spotlight: Comparing RTPs Across Popular UK Slots
| Slot Game | RTP (%) | Volatility | Key Features |
|---|---|---|---|
| Book of Dead | 96.21 | Medium | Free Spins, Expanding Symbols |
| Starburst | 96.09 | Low | Re-Spins, Wilds |
| Gonzo’s Quest | 96.00 | Medium | Avalanche Reels, Free Fall |
| Fishin’ Frenzy | 96.11 | Low | Bonus Game, Free Spins |
This comparative snapshot illustrates that many popular UK slots hover around an RTP of approximately 96%, aligning with the industry standard. However, the integration of bonus features and volatility levels further tunes the player experience, underscoring the importance of holistic game design.
